BSc (Hons) User Experience Design is a 3-year bachelor programme in Design and Creative Arts at Manchester Metropolitan University in Manchester, United Kingdom. Teaching is in English. Tuition is £21,500 GBP per year. Intake is in Sep. Scholarships are available for this programme.

BSc (Hons) User Experience Design is a Bachelor program in Design and Creative Arts offered by Manchester Metropolitan University in Manchester, United Kingdom.
Tuition is £21,500 GBP per year.
Minimum qualification required: Require 65% and above in Higher Secondary School Certificate (Standard 12th) (65% from West Bengal Board) [70% from CISCE (ISC)] (75% from CBSE and Maharashtra Board) and (80% from All Other State Boards).
An IELTS score of at least 6.0 is required. Alternatively, a TOEFL score of 79.0 or a PTE score of 61.0 may be accepted.
No, this program does not require a GRE or GMAT score for admission.
